About the Role

We are looking for a Quality Engineer to join our rapidly growing venture-backed company. The Quality Engineer will be responsible for ensuring optimal quality and reliability in the manufacturing operations. This role will be dedicated to managing the quality management system, identifying and resolving defects or issues by supporting the manufacturing teams to achieve a zero-defect process standard. Through data-driven decisions, this role requires defining best practices, developing calibration systems, and continuously improving quality standards to ensure both internal and external customers receive the product on time with minimal variation.

What You'll Do

  • Ensure compliance with relevant FDA or ISO standards throughout all quality processes and documentation to meet regulatory requirements.
  • Take full responsibility for the operation and management of the quality management system, aligning with Process Control Document standards.
  • Oversee the corrective action and preventive action (CAPA) processes for both materials and production methods.
  • Utilize cross-functional teams and tools such as DMAIC (Define, Measure, Analyze, Improve, Control) and Design of Experiments (DOE) to address and solve issues.
  • Establish procedures that uphold and manage audits to support document control systems
  • Prepare quality reports and track actions to achievement of world-class quality, both internally and externally.
  • Monitor and report on key quality objectives and results.
  • Initiate and develop programs that drive continuous improvement in manufacturing practices.
  • Conduct training sessions for operational staff to enhance skill levels and knowledge for quality sustainability.
  • Regularly monitor and report on production line first pass yield.
  • Investigate quality discrepancies, recommend, and assist in the implementation of corrective actions.
  • Participate in cross-functional teams to address and complete safety, quality, or continuous improvement tasks within designated process areas.
  • Liaise with customers, providing necessary support and interface to meet quality expectations.
  • Develop and implement projects aimed at continuous improvement and process optimization.
What We're Looking For
  • Bachelor's Degree - Chemical, Electrical, Mechanical, or Materials Engineering from a four-year university
  • Experience with FDA and ISO regulatory standards to enhance quality system compliance and operational excellence.
  • Minimum of two years of experience as a Quality Engineer, or Quality manager role
  • Demonstrated 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, and draw valid conclusions
  • Demonstrated ability to interpret extensive abstract and concrete variables
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ills, with ability to speak effectively before groups of customers or employees of the organization
  • Current computer literacy including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
  • Experience in Lean Manufacturing and/or Six Sigma continuous improvement programs
  • Experience with SPC and other statistical techniques
  • Able to travel 5 - 10%
